

Pamela Ann Scott was received into the hands of our Lord on June 20, 2013 and was welcomed with love by her proud parents, Ivan and Ann Kollasch. She is survived by her loving husband Michael, son John Dinubilo and wife Christa, grandchildren Sophia and Noah, sister Nancy Kollasch Combs, brother David Kollasch, and many caring family members. She also leaves behind many close friends whose lives she touched in very special ways. Pamela attended high school and college in Arizona and graduated from Sam Houston State University in Huntsville, TX. She retired from banking and teaching to take up quilting, scrapbooking, gardening, and many other activities. In the last months of her time on Earth, she fulfilled a lifelong goal and wrote a book, “One Foot in Heaven” which continues to touch everyone who reads it. She was an active member of St. Michael’s Catholic Church in Snohomish and was a ministry to God, her church, her family and her many friends. Her Faith was strong, inspiring and enduring. She will be greatly missed by all.
A Rosary will be said at St. Michael’s Catholic Church, 1512 Pine Ave. in Snohomish, WA on Thursday, June 27, at 6:00 PM and services will be conducted at St. Michael’s on Friday, June 28 at 11AM. Pamela will be laid to rest at Queen of Heaven Catholic Cemetery in Mesa, AZ.
In lieu of flowers, the family requests that donations be provided to the American Cancer Society in memory of Pamela Scott and that they be designated for breast cancer.
